    Images capture exact moment Israeli missile hit building in Beirut | Israel attacks Lebanon News

    Taking cowl behind a big tree, a photographer from The Related Press information company pointed his digicam in direction of an condominium constructing in Beirut that the Israeli army warned was in its sights.

    When a missile plunged from the sky moments later, the photojournalist and his lens have been completely positioned to doc the path of destruction – second by second, body by body.

    “I heard the sound of the missile whistling, headed towards the constructing after which I began filming,” photographer Bilal Hussein mentioned on Tuesday, hours after Israeli forces launched the assault. The photographs Hussein captured of the projectile, frozen in mid-flight earlier than obliterating the construction, present a hanging take a look at the velocity, energy and devastation of recent warfare.

    The strike on Tuesday got here roughly 40 minutes after an Israeli army spokesperson posted a warning in Arabic on social media, notifying folks in and round a pair of buildings within the southern suburbs of the Lebanese capital that they need to evacuate the world.

    He didn’t clarify why the buildings have been being focused, apart from to say they have been close to “pursuits and amenities” related to the Hezbollah group.

    The warning prompted many individuals to flee the busy, densely populated neighbourhood, at the same time as others, together with a number of journalists, saved watch. By the point of the assault, the constructing had been evacuated and there have been no studies of casualties.

    Minutes earlier than the missile introduced down the constructing, two smaller projectiles have been fired on the roof in what Israel’s army usually refers to as warning strikes, in response to the AP journalists on the scene. It’s a follow Israel has adopted in strikes within the Gaza Strip.

    When the first missile hurtled in direction of the constructing it was a blur, however Hussein’s digicam offered witness.

    One image confirmed the missile arching by way of the air. One other captured it a fraction of a second earlier than it smashed by way of a lower-floor balcony.

    Within the photos that adopted, a cloud of smoke and particles billowed outwards because the constructing collapsed.
